Benchmark nickel on the London Metal Exchange hit a 16-month peak earlier this month on fears major producer Indonesia would bring forward an export ban of ore. On Friday, LME nickel shed 0.3% to $16,200 a tonne in final open-outcry trading, as investors took profits on a rally that has sent prices up 35% since early July.

Every metal traded on the LME must conform to strict specifications regarding quality, lot size and shape. Each LME tradeable contract is likewise governed by rules covering (but not limited to) prompt dates, settlement terms, traded and cleared currencies and minimum tick size.

LONDON (Reuters) – The London Metal Exchange has asked members to report any unusual activity in nickel trading after prices lurched up and down in the wake of large transactions last week, sources familiar with the matter said. Sources said the LME sent an email last week asking about reasons for the nickel trading carried out for clients.

London Metal Exchange pricing "LME setting the global standard" The London Metal Exchange was founded in the year 1877, but has a history from the year 1571. LME is now the world's leading market for non-ferrous metals. LME prices are very important for companies who trade in these metals.
